Zillow Group Prices Public Offerings of $384 million of Class C Capital Stock and $500 million of 2.75% Convertible Senior Notes due 2025

May 13, 2020

SEATTLE, May 13, 2020 /PRNewswire/ --  Zillow Group, Inc. (NASDAQ:Z) (NASDAQ:ZG) announced today the pricing of concurrent underwritten public offerings of 8,000,000 shares of its Class C capital stock (the "Shares") at a price to the public of $48.00 per share and $500 million aggregate principal amount of its 2.75% convertible senior notes due 2025 (the "Notes"). Zillow Group also granted the underwriters of the Shares offering (the "Shares Offering") a 30-day option to purchase up to an additional 1,200,000 Shares and the underwriters of the Notes offering (the "Notes Offering") a 30-day option to purchase up to an additional $75 million aggregate principal amount of Notes, in each case solely to cover over-allotments. The Shares Offering and the Notes Offering are both expected to settle on May 15, 2020, in each case subject to customary closing conditions.

Zillow Group expects that the net proceeds from the Shares Offering will be approximately $374.1 million (or $430.2 million if the underwriters exercise their option to purchase additional Shares in full) and expects that the net proceeds from the Notes Offering will be approximately $489.6 million (or $563.1 million if the underwriters exercise their option to purchase additional Notes in full), in each case after deducting underwriting discounts and commissions and estimated offering expenses payable by Zillow Group. Neither offering is contingent on the completion of the other offering. Zillow Group intends to use the net proceeds from the Notes Offering and the Shares Offering to repurchase a portion of its outstanding 2.00% Convertible Senior Notes due 2021 (the "2021 Notes"), in separate and privately negotiated transactions (the "2021 Note Repurchase Transactions") and for general corporate purposes, which may include general and administrative matters and capital expenditures. Additionally, Zillow Group may choose to use a portion of the net proceeds to expand its current business through acquisitions of, or investments in, other businesses, products or technologies. However, Zillow Group has no definitive agreements or commitments with respect to any such acquisitions or investments at this time.

Concurrently with the Shares Offering and Notes Offering, Zillow Group plans to enter into the 2021 Note Repurchase Transactions with certain holders of a portion of the 2021 Notes. Pursuant to the 2021 Note Repurchase Transactions, Zillow Group expects to repurchase an aggregate principal amount of $194.7 million of the 2021 Notes for a total repurchase cost of $232.6 million, consisting of $196.4 million in cash and 753,936 shares of Class C capital stock (based on the public offering price of the Shares in the Shares Offering). 

In connection with the 2021 Note Repurchase Transactions, Zillow Group entered into agreements with certain of the counterparties to capped call transactions it entered into in connection with the issuance of the 2021 Notes to unwind a portion of those capped call transactions. Under the agreements, Zillow Group will receive from the capped call counterparties shares of its Class C capital stock as a termination payment in respect of the portion of the capped call transactions unwound. Zillow Group may also unwind remaining capped call transactions at any time immediately following the completion of the offerings. In connection with any of the foregoing transactions, the capped call counterparties may sell shares of Zillow Group's Class C capital stock, or unwind various derivative transactions related to the Class C capital stock, which may affect the price of the Class C capital stock.

The Notes will be senior, unsecured obligations of Zillow Group, and will mature on May 15, 2025, unless earlier repurchased, redeemed or converted in accordance with their terms. The Notes will bear interest at a fixed rate of 2.75% per year, payable semi-annually in arrears on May 15 and November 15 of each year, beginning on November 15, 2020.

Prior to the close of business on the business day immediately preceding November 15, 2024, the Notes will be convertible at the option of the holder of the Notes only under certain conditions. On or after November 15, 2024, until the close of business on the second scheduled trading day immediately preceding the relevant maturity date, holders of Notes may convert their Notes at their option at the conversion rate then in effect, irrespective of these conditions. Zillow Group will settle conversions of the Notes by paying or delivering, as the case may be, cash, shares of its Class C capital stock, or a combination of cash and shares of its Class C capital stock, at its election.

The conversion rate will initially be 14.8810 shares of Class C capital stock per $1,000 principal amount of Notes (equivalent to an initial conversion price of approximately $67.20 per share of Class C capital stock). The conversion rate and the corresponding conversion price will be subject to adjustment in some events but will not be adjusted for any accrued and unpaid interest. Zillow Group may redeem for cash all or part of the Notes, at its option, on or after November 15, 2024, under certain circumstances at a redemption price equal to 100% of the principal amount of the Notes to be redeemed, plus accrued and unpaid interest to, but excluding, the redemption date (as defined in the indenture governing the Notes).

If Zillow Group undergoes a fundamental change (as defined in the indenture governing the Notes), holders of Notes may require Zillow Group to repurchase for cash all or part of their Notes at a repurchase price equal to 100% of the principal amount of the Notes to be purchased, plus accrued and unpaid interest to, but excluding, the fundamental change repurchase date (as defined in the indenture governing the Notes). In addition, if certain fundamental changes occur or Zillow Group delivers a notice of redemption, Zillow Group may be required in certain circumstances to increase the conversion rate for any Notes converted in connection with such fundamental changes or notice of redemption by a specified number of shares of its Class C capital stock.

Morgan Stanley & Co. LLC, Goldman Sachs & Co. LLC, Citigroup Global Markets, Inc., and Credit Suisse Securities (USA) LLC are acting as joint book-running managers for the Shares Offering and the Notes Offering. Craig-Hallum Capital Group LLC and D.A. Davidson & Co. are acting as co-managers for the Shares Offering and the Notes Offering.
